Sauti East Africa Launches Usheeg in Somalia

Sauti East Africa, in partnership with IOM Somalia, has launched Usheeg, a mobile information platform providing displaced and marginalized women traders in Beledweyne and Jowhar with free, real-time access to essential services and market data.

Across Somalia, women and youth traders face persistent challenges: limited access to reliable market data, vulnerability to exploitation by brokers and money changers, and exposure to climate risks such as drought and flooding. These barriers undermine their ability to trade safely and profitably.

Usheeg addresses these challenges directly by providing an easily accessible mobile-based resource that they can access the information they need to work safely and get the protection services they need.

A Platform Built for Accessibility

By dialing *567# from any kind of phone with access to the Hormuud network, traders can access Usheeg and access:

  • Market prices updated daily from trusted sources such as FAO FSNAU
  • Weather forecasts and early warnings from ICPAC, SWALIM, and OCHA
  • Exchange rates for key regional and international currencies
  • Protection and social services including gender-based violence support and referrals

The service operates entirely via USSD and SMS, requiring no internet connection or smartphone, and is available in local Somali dialects and English. This ensures inclusive access to information across diverse user groups.

Impact in the First Month

In its first four weeks of implementation, Usheeg has achieved measurable reach and adoption:

Why It Matters

Access to accurate, timely information enables traders to negotiate confidently, adapt to climate variability, and identify safe options for accessing services. By strengthening decision-making and reducing exposure to risks, Usheeg is helping to enhance market efficiency, resilience, and economic opportunities for Somali traders.

Next Steps

Building on the initial launch, Sauti East Africa and IOM Somalia will:

  • Expand Usheegโ€™s coverage to additional markets across Somalia

  • Integrate new data streams on food supply, climate, and social services

  • Continue user testing and feedback sessions to ensure platform relevance and effectiveness

  • Scale outreach through radio, posters, and trusted local networks

The goal is to establish Usheeg as a trusted, accessible, and sustainable information platform for Somaliaโ€™s traders and communities.
